The diameter of a bacteria colony that doubles every hour is represented by the graph below. What is the diameter of the bacteria after 9 hours? (0,1) (1,2) (2,4) (3,8)

Answers:
128
256
512
1024

As the colony doubles every hour, the population
p is modeled by:


p = 2^t

Where
t is the time in hours.

We can see this because:


2^0 = 1 \\ 2^1 = 2 \\ 2^2 = 4

Notice that the x coordinate of the graph corresponds to the time, and the y coordinate corresponds to the population.

Thus at
t=9


p=2^9 \\ \\ p = \boxed{512}
